diff --git a/xml/htdocs/security/en/glsa/glsa-200311-04.xml b/xml/htdocs/security/en/glsa/glsa-200311-04.xml new file mode 100644 index 00000000..e126b59b --- /dev/null +++ b/xml/htdocs/security/en/glsa/glsa-200311-04.xml @@ -0,0 +1,67 @@ +<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?> +<!DOCTYPE glsa SYSTEM "http://www.gentoo.org/dtd/glsa.dtd"> +<?xml-stylesheet href="/xsl/glsa.xsl" type="text/xsl"?> +<?xml-stylesheet href="/xsl/guide.xsl" type="text/xsl"?> + +<glsa id="200311-04"> + <title>FreeRADIUS: heap exploit and NULL pointer dereference vulnerability</title> + <synopsis> + FreeRADIUS is vulnerable to a heap exploit and a NULL pointer dereference + vulnerability. + </synopsis> + <product type="ebuild">FreeRADIUS</product> + <announced>2003-11-23</announced> + <revised>2003-11-23: 01</revised> + <bug>33989</bug> + <access>remote</access> + <affected> + <package name="net-dialup/freeradius" auto="yes" arch="*"> + <unaffected range="ge">0.9.3</unaffected> + <vulnerable range="le">0.9.2</vulnerable> + </package> + </affected> + <background> + <p> + FreeRADIUS is a popular open source RADIUS server. + </p> + </background> + <description> + <p> + FreeRADIUS versions below 0.9.3 are vulnerable to a heap exploit, however, + the attack code must be in the form of a valid RADIUS packet which limits + the possible exploits. + </p> + <p> + Also corrected in the 0.9.3 release is another vulnerability which causes + the RADIUS server to de-reference a NULL pointer and crash when an + Access-Request packet with a Tunnel-Password is received. + </p> + </description> + <impact type="normal"> + <p> + A remote attacker could craft a RADIUS packet which would cause the RADIUS + server to crash, or could possibly overflow the heap resulting in a system + compromise. + </p> + </impact> + <workaround> + <p> + There is no known workaround at this time. + </p> + </workaround> + <resolution> + <p> + Users are encouraged to perform an 'emerge sync' and upgrade the package to + the latest available version - 0.9.3 is available in portage and is marked + as stable. + </p> + <code> + # emerge sync + # emerge -pv '>=net-dialup/freeradius-0.9.3' + # emerge '>=net-dialup/freeradius-0.9.3' + # emerge clean</code> + </resolution> + <references> + <uri link="http://www.securitytracker.com/alerts/2003/Nov/1008263.html">SecurityTracker.com Security Alert</uri> + </references> +</glsa> |
